Created by Patt Murray
in 1979 and inspired by a mix of the 18th century French "salon" model (a group of people who gather to exchange
ideas) and Baba Ram Dass’s "Be Here Now" (a book about the pleasure of existence),
As You Like It is in its 5th incarnation at 827 Chicago Ave in Evanston.
Upon entering, our guests are able to discuss or to listen,to feel at ease or travel deep into thought,
to be and enjoy. A true "salon" allows us to consider the new and rethink the old on the way to
finding individual solutions for each guest, keeping our craft alive and vibrant. We invite you to benefit from the expert craftsmanship, excellent design work,
caring service, and personal responsibility that our guests have come to expect.
